Cushion gum extruder (CTC)
The VMI-AZ Extrusion CTC (Cushion-To-Casing) system, with (optional) building machine for pre-cured treads, uses an extruder to directly extrude hot cushion gum onto the buffed casing surface, thus directly replacing the process of wrapping calandered sheet cushion gum around the buffed casing. Single size extruder feed strip is drawn into the extruder feed section, heated up by being plastisized in the mixing section of the extruder and then forced through the 420 mm wide CTC extrusion head directly onto the buffed casing.
Since the CTC skive filling action is an automatic process, it is far more reliable than the skive filling operation as performed by an operator with a hand held extruder. Cushion gum width is adjusted by moveable slides, which change the die opening width of the extrusion head. Specially shaped quick-change side-dies are also available so that cushion gum can be partially extruded on the casing shoulder in order to accomodate pre-cured tread with sings or contour sides.
The VMI-AZ Extrusion CTC system comes in two models, i.e.: The extruder builder CTC-SB I and the extruder builder CTC-SB VII.

Retread systems for earth mover tires
VMI-AZ is one of the market leaders for retread systems for truck and passenger tires. Based on this experience a new system has been developed to enable retreading of earth mover tires. Main components of this system are the base constructor and the strip builder.
The base constructor consists of three PIN-Extruders attached to a special retread extrusion head that supplies rubber to the tire carcass. This set-up smears rubber onto the tire carcass while the carcass is rotating. The so called cushion to casing technology is already well known from VMI-AZ retread machinery.
If the base is built-up by the base constructor the tire can be moved to the strip builder position. At the strip builder a hot extruded rubber strip is supplied to the tire carcass for building-up the new tread. To ensure high precision the Shark® extruder gear pump system is used for extruding the strip.
OTR Strip Builder for Treads
The Strip Builder builds-up the tread of OTR tires. This VMI-AZ strip building systems consists of a gear pump extruder system, a tire stand and the control system.

Thanks to the volumetric gear pump the strip is extruded onto the carcass directly. The strip apply position and the tread build-up is controlled by the laser sensor and the software program. Customers’ different tread requirements can be stored in the HMI.
